2017-01-10 3 views
0

У меня возникла проблема с CircleCI.sqlite3.h не найдена ошибка на CircleCI на iOS

Приложение iOS отлично компилируется на моей локальной машине, но кажется, что на CircleCi нет файла sqlite3.h на своих машинах или, по крайней мере, он не находится в том же каталоге.

Здесь часть журнала CicleCI: enter image description here

Эта проблема, это связано с стручка именем GRDB.swift. если я открою модуль, это то, что я вижу: enter image description here

как я могу его решить?

ответ

0

Карты карт Swift содержат абсолютные пути. И это очень больно, потому что это заставляет Xcode находиться в определенном месте.

Решение должно состоять в том, чтобы CircleCI разместил Xcode на своем обычном месте. Другим решением было бы изменить карту модуля до его создания.

Пожалуйста, сообщите, пожалуйста, свое окончательное решение, потому что оно будет бесценным для многих пользователей.

Смежные вопросы